| ESV |
saying, “Where is he who has been born king of the Jews? For we saw his star when it rose and have come to worship him.”
|
| NIV |
and asked, “Where is the one who has been born king of the Jews? We saw his star in the east and have come to worship him.”
|
| NLT |
“Where is the newborn king of the Jews? We saw his star as it rose, and we have come to worship him.”
|
| KJV |
Saying, Where is he that is born King of the Jews? for we have seen his star in the east, and are come to worship him.
